PET / CT Technologist

The Nuclear Medicine Technologist, responsible for performing all Nuclear Medicine patient care services. In addition, they ensure the well-being of patients and provide a positive, supportive environment while working in conjunction with physicians, advanced practice clinicians, front office, and clinical staff.This role requires working in a clinical setting with the team in a collaborative workflow model.

Primary Responsibilities : The PET / CT Technologist operates computed tomography (CT) and Positron Emission Tomography (PET)

  • Prepare and transmit images to the radiologist for read and report results to providers
  • Retrieve and archive radiographic reports
  • Review (accuracy check) and complete provider orders
  • Perform detailed and accurate data collection during clinical intake of patients to include taking and recording vital signs and patient history
  • Assist patients as needed with walking, transfer, exam prep, etc.
  • Proper, concise, and complete EMR documentation and paper-based documentation for all assessments and procedures
  • Perform accurate PET / CT exam as ordered by the provider while practicing radiation safety precautions.
  • Reviews exam orders for scheduling and protocol accuracy
  • Ensures that information essential to daily operations is passed between the technologists, receptionists, radiologist on duty, and Lead / Managers
  • Prepares and administers contrast media and radiopharmaceuticals according to site-specific protocols and under the direction of the Radiologist
  • Assists patient on to examination table and adjusts positioning devices to obtain optimum views of specified area of body requested by Physician

Nuclear Medicine Technologist requirements

  • Graduate of an accredited Nuclear Medicine program and hold an active CNMT or ARRT(N) Certification
  • Documented training and experience in CT. ARRT registered (RT) and radiography (R) and / or computed tomography (CT) certified and / or NMTCB registered (CNMT)
  • Detailed knowledge of PET and CT equipment protocols
